What is Urticaria (Hives)?
Urticaria is an allergic or immune-related skin reaction that results in raised, itchy welts on the skin. These welts may vary in size and can appear anywhere on the body. In some cases, urticaria is accompanied by angioedema, which is deeper swelling around the eyes, lips, or throat.
There are two main types:
- Acute urticaria (short-term)
- Chronic urticaria (long-lasting)
Types of Urticaria
Acute Urticaria
Acute urticaria usually lasts less than six weeks and is often triggered by:
- Food allergies (nuts, seafood, eggs)
- Infections
- Medications
- Insect bites
Chronic Urticaria
Chronic urticaria lasts longer than six weeks and may have no identifiable cause. It is often linked to:
- Autoimmune conditions
- Internal inflammation
- Unknown triggers
Physical Urticaria
This type is triggered by external physical factors such as:
- Heat or cold exposure
- Pressure on the skin
- Exercise or sweating
Symptoms of Urticaria
Common symptoms include:
- Red or skin-colored raised welts
- Severe itching
- Burning or stinging sensation
- Swelling (angioedema in severe cases)
- Rash that changes location quickly

Causes of Urticaria
Urticaria can be triggered by both allergic and non-allergic factors.
Allergic Triggers
- Food allergies
- Drug reactions
- Pollen, dust, and environmental allergens
Non-Allergic Triggers
- Stress and anxiety
- Viral infections
- Autoimmune disorders
- Temperature changes

Diagnosis of Urticaria in Lake Forest
Diagnosis usually includes:
- Physical examination of the skin
- Allergy testing (skin prick or blood tests)
- Medical history evaluation
- Trigger identification
Advanced diagnostic tools help dermatologists and allergy specialists create a personalized treatment plan.
When to See a Doctor
You should consult a specialist if:
- Hives last longer than 6 weeks
- Symptoms keep returning
- You experience swelling of lips or throat
- Over-the-counter treatments do not work
Early diagnosis ensures faster relief and prevents complications.
Urticaria Treatment Options
Treatment depends on severity and underlying causes.
Antihistamines
First-line treatment to reduce itching and allergic response.
Corticosteroids
Used for short-term control of severe inflammation.
Biologic Therapy
For chronic cases that do not respond to standard treatments (e.g., omalizumab).
Lifestyle Management
- Avoid known triggers
- Manage stress levels
- Follow allergy-safe diet plans
